QSP Evidence Match Gate
Stage328は、Stage327で作った 再現証拠スキーマ を土台にして、 AIの脆弱性指摘と再現証拠が本当に一致しているかを判定します。
つまり、Stage327は 証拠を構造化する段階、 Stage328は その証拠がAI Claimと一致するか判定する段階 です。
AI Claim ↓ Reproduction Evidence ↓ same_target / evidence_files_present / sha256_bound / signature_present ↓ QSP Evidence Match Gate ↓ accept / pending / reject
AIの脆弱性指摘と、実際の再現証拠を入力し、 Stage327形式の構造化JSONを生成し、さらにStage328のGate判定を行います。
ここに生成結果が表示されます。
ここに判定結果が表示されます。
accept:same_target / evidence_files_present / sha256_bound / signature_present がすべて true
pending:対象と証拠はあるが、SHA256または署名が不足
reject:対象が違う、または証拠ファイルがない
Stage327は、再現証拠を 標準構造化 しました。
Stage328は、その構造化された証拠がAI Claimと一致するかを確認し、 accept / pending / reject に変換します。
JSONキーは翻訳してはいけません。
vulnerability_type,
target,
ai_claim_id,
reproduction_id,
evidence_files,
sha256,
same_target,
sha256_bound
は固定です。